Construction contractor builds fuel-efficient fleet with Mercedes vans18 June 2014

Construction contractor MJ Abbott has extended its 60-strong fleet with 13 new Mercedes vehicles, including Sprinters, Citans and a pair of Sprinter 4x4 panel vans.

Supplied by dealer Rygor, the Salisbury-based contractor's latest additions are mostly 3.5-tonne Sprinter 313 CDIs.

Four are standard panels vans, and the line-up also includes the two 4x4s as well as a Dualiner crew variant with a second row of seats, and a chassis cab with dropside body. Completing the order are three Citan 109 CDIs and a pair of Vito 116 CDI Dualiners.

"The 4x4 Sprinters will certainly improve our off-road capability, as they offer a much higher carrying capacity than our other four wheel-drive vehicles," says technical director Adrian Abbott.

The dropsider, he adds, has a longer body than the van it replaces, so offers more versatility as a delivery vehicle.

Meanwhile, this is the first time MJ Abbott has ordered the Citan. "We'll be monitoring the performance of our first Citans closely, to see how they shape up against our established small vans. First impressions are certainly very positive though," states Abbott.

The vehicles will be maintained in-house by MJ Abbott's engineers. All have been assigned to the company's civil engineering, electrical, water and wastewater engineering teams.
